Subject: Discount policy for large deals — transition briefing

Executive team,

As Director-designate Halloway takes over next week, I want to document our current approach carefully. Deals above the volume threshold require dual sign-off; discounts beyond fifteen percent escalate to Finance. Recent exceptions on the Verdantis account caused margin erosion we cannot repeat. The reasoning behind these guardrails ties to our broader plans, summarized confidentially below.

internal memo for kawip-hadug: Headcount on the Wenwyn team goes from 7 to 140 by the end of January. Gross margin on Wenwyn came in at 20 percent against a plan of 15 percent.

// MAX_TILE_CACHE_ENTRIES governs the Wrenfold tile-rendering cache layer.
// We cap entries rather than bytes because tile payloads in the Copperline
// basemap are near-uniform (~14KB), making entry counts a reliable proxy.
// Raising this beyond 50,000 caused eviction-thrash during the Halloway
// load test, so any change must be paired with a fresh soak run and sign-off
// at the weekly sync. The soak run that validated the current value is
// referenced by the token below.

build token for hafop-fawif: htk31_9758d5e565aa3b14f55d629377373c4

### Checklist item 7: Nightly backfill scheduler (Lumenfall)

Before tagging the release, confirm the backfill scheduler picks up the new cron manifest and that overlapping windows are rejected, not queued. Run the dry-run harness against yesterday's partition set and verify zero duplicate job IDs in the planner output. Future maintainers: this gate exists because silent double-backfills corrupted aggregates twice in the past. Record the verification by pasting the build token below.

session token of kageg-tahop = htk14_af3c1ccccb7dcf